gaymelancholy

Yeah they usually only get them if they have volume space to fill. Recent ones include Cipher Academy, Super Smartphone, and the ones I mentioned above. There are probably more but those are the only ones I cared to look up. You can find the raws on certain (non legal) websites, and sometimes people translate them.

Sigilbreaker26

MMA series have trouble getting cut through since they're slightly too violent for sports manga fans and not flashy enough for fighting series fans. Asumi was also held back by the author somewhat rushing some reveals early on that reduced the tension; his brother went from an antagonist to basically his manager pulling strings so the drama was dead. I think that first volume was a terrific start but everything after his brother kicked his ass simply blew its load too quickly.
